How to find the mode.

Mathematics
2 answers:
Lady_Fox [76]2 years ago
5 0

Answer:

To find the mode, order the numbers lowest to highest and see which number appears the most often.

Step-by-step explanation: The mode is the number that appears most frequently in a data set. If no Number repeats at all, then there is no mode. A data set can also have multiple modes if different numbers repeat the same amount of times.

How many solutions does this equation have?
kozerog [31]

Hello from MrBillDoesMath!


Answer: infinite solutions


Discussion: I did a double take on this one but  the left hand is

a + 3 + 2a =  3a +3

and the right hand side is

-1 + 3a + 4 = 3a + (4-1) = 3a + 3


The left and right sides of the equation are identical for all "a", i.e. for infinitely many "a" values.
